The Ken Jones site isn't showing any info yet, but from an email:
Demo Day is On
Catch the KJ Team along with major brands including Atomic, Black Crows, Dynastar, Elan, Fischer, Head, Rossingol, K2, Salomon and more at Waterville Valley Friday December 9th, 2022!

Demo Day Tickets are available In-Store. A select number of tickets will be available day of. When you purchase your ticket at Ken Jones you will leave with your Direct to Lift RFID valid for December 9th, 2022 and your demo day card. The demo day card allows skiers to try as many skis as they'd like throughout the day. Make sure to keep both the RFID and Demo Day Card in a safe place until Demo Day. Ken Jones is not liable for lost, or misplaced cards.

We've compiled a list of FAQs and answers. Take a look below to get all the details for this years demo day.

  • What do I need to have to purchase my Demo Ticket at Ken Jones?
    • You'll need a valid form of payment, Drivers License, Height, Weight, Boot Sole Length (found here), and approximate din setting (found here).
  • If I have a Season's pass or Day Pass to Waterville Valley for Dec 9th do I still need to pay for a demo day card?
    • You do not need to pay for a Ticket, but you will need to come to Ken Jones Prior to Demo Day to fill out your Demo Day Card
  • What happens if I lose my Demo Day Card or RFID before Demo Day?
    • You will not be able to participate in Demo Day. No exceptions.
  • What if I'm buying tickets for multiple people at once?
    • Make you have all their information listed above before purchasing multiple tickets.
  • Am I able to order tickets over the phone?
    • Tickets are only available in store on a first come, first serve basis.

Ragged just announced a couple of demo days:

Friday, Jan. 20: Telemark Down x Fey Brothers Ski Demo – try the latest and greatest tele skis and bindings on-snow with a lap or two down Newfound Ridge.

Sat. & Sun. Jan. 28-29: Black Crows Ski Demo x Ski Sauvage - This is your opportunity to try out Black Crow skis on the slopes of Ragged Mountain! The regional reps will be present to answer questions and get you on the best models that suit your ability and style. Pre-registration for the event is available here: www.black-crows.com/us/

Whaleback Mtn, off I89 Exit 16 in NH, along with Omer and Bob's Ski, Tennis and Bike Shop, will be hosting a free demo day on March 4 (this Saturday) from 10 to 3. Blizzard, Elan, Nordica and Volkl.
